How this ranking works

Ratings come from our statistical models of runner reviews: the score is our best estimate of how a shoe is rated, and the bar behind it in an expanded row is the range we consider plausible given how many reviews it has. Shoes with few reviews rank more cautiously rather than shooting to the top on a handful of glowing write-ups. Prices are the live prices at the retailers we track, and everything ranked here is a shoe you can buy today.
